Living Legends: Music Directors
a. R. Rahman (Jan. 6, 1966 – Present) Allah-Rakhā Rahman is one of the most versatile music composer, producer, and singer-songwriters working in the Indian film industry. He is also a philanthropist, working with numerous charities. He was born in Chennai, Tamil Nadu. His father, R. K. Shekhar was a Tamil and Malayalam film composer who died when A.R. Rahman was very young. In 1988, A.R. Rahman, born as A.S. Dileep Kumar, and members of his family converted to Islam. Over the course of his career, he has composed music for films and albums in many languages. He is skilled in Carnatic, Hindustani classical, Western, pop-rock, reggae, Sufi and Qawāli styles of music. Rahman has shown interest in experimentation mixing genres of music with electronica and digital technologies. He got his first big break when he got the National film award as a best music composer for the Tamil film Rojā in 1992. It was also dubbed in Hindi. His global popularity spiked after his soundtrack work for the 2008 film Slumdog Millionaire won him Academy Awards for Best original score and Best original song for “Jai Ho.” He is married to Sairā Bānu and has three children: Khatijā, Rahimā and Ameen. Some of his most cherished non-film compositions include the patriotic song “Vande Mātaram,” which he composed for India’s 50th anniversary of its independence in 1997 and “Jai Jai Garavi Gujarat” in 2010, in honor of the 50th anniversary of the Gujarat State. He has performed all over the world. Visit his website: arrahman.com for more info.

Some awards Padma Shri from the Government of India, 2 Academy and 2 Grammy Awards, a BAFTA Award, a Golden Globe, 4 National Film Awards, lifetime achievement award in 2008, Many Filmfare awards for Hindi and south Indian films, and innumerable others.
